Understanding Machine Learning Solutions

Machine learning solutions refer to algorithms and models that allow computers to analyze patterns in data and make predictions without being explicitly programmed. These systems continuously learn and improve as they process more data, making them highly effective for tasks such as image recognition, fraud detection, and recommendation systems.

There are three main types of machine learning:

  1. Supervised Learning – The model is trained on labeled data, meaning the input comes with corresponding correct outputs. This is commonly used for spam detection, customer segmentation, and sales forecasting.
  2. Unsupervised Learning – The algorithm identifies patterns and relationships in data without predefined labels. Businesses use this for market research, anomaly detection, and clustering customer preferences.
  3. Reinforcement Learning – The system learns through trial and error, receiving feedback in the form of rewards or penalties. This approach is used in robotics, gaming, and automated decision-making processes.

Understanding these types helps businesses choose the right machine learning solutions to address their specific needs.

Steps to Implement Machine Learning Solutions

Integrating machine learning solutions into a business requires a structured approach. Here are the key steps to ensure successful implementation:

  1. Define the Problem – Identify the business challenge you want to solve with machine learning. Whether it’s improving customer retention, optimizing logistics, or detecting fraudulent transactions, having a clear goal is essential.
  2. Collect and Prepare Data – Machine learning models rely on high-quality data. Gather relevant information from internal databases, customer interactions, and external sources. Clean and preprocess the data to remove errors, duplicates, and inconsistencies.
  3. Select the Right Model – Depending on your objective, choose an appropriate machine learning model. For example, a decision tree may be suitable for classification tasks, while a neural network is better for image recognition.
  4. Train and Test the Model – Use a portion of the data to train the model and another portion to evaluate its accuracy. Fine-tune parameters to improve performance and ensure reliability in real-world applications.
  5. Deploy and Monitor Performance – Once the model is ready, integrate it into your business operations. Continuously monitor its performance and make adjustments as necessary to maintain accuracy and efficiency.

By following these steps, businesses can successfully implement machine learning solutions that drive measurable improvements.

Benefits of Machine Learning Solutions

Adopting machine learning solutions offers several advantages that can significantly enhance business performance:

  • Improved Decision-Making – Machine learning models analyze vast amounts of data to provide accurate predictions and insights, helping businesses make informed strategic decisions.
  • Process Automation – Tasks such as data entry, customer support, and inventory management can be automated, reducing human workload and increasing efficiency.
  • Enhanced Customer Experience – Personalized recommendations, chatbots, and sentiment analysis help businesses engage with customers in a more meaningful and efficient way.
  • Fraud Detection and Risk Management – Machine learning algorithms identify suspicious patterns in transactions, preventing fraud and minimizing financial risks.
  • Optimized Marketing Strategies – By analyzing customer behavior, businesses can tailor marketing campaigns to specific audiences, improving conversion rates and customer retention.

Machine learning solutions are becoming a necessity for companies that want to remain competitive in a data-driven world. By implementing the right strategies, businesses can unlock new opportunities, streamline operations, and deliver better experiences to their customers.